The global GMSL2 Camera Module Market is poised for substantial growth in the coming years, fueled by rapid technological advancements and rising demand for high-definition imaging solutions. GMSL2 (Gigabit Multimedia Serial Link 2) camera modules are increasingly integrated into advanced driver-assistance systems (ADAS), infotainment systems, and industrial automation applications, driving their adoption worldwide.
These camera modules offer high-speed data transfer, minimal latency, and robust performance under diverse conditions. Their ability to support multiple lanes of high-resolution video transmission makes them ideal for automotive safety applications and industrial machine vision systems. As demand for smarter and safer vehicles intensifies, the GMSL2 camera module market is expected to see significant expansion across regions.
Technological innovation remains a key market driver. Manufacturers are focusing on developing miniaturized, cost-effective, and energy-efficient camera modules to meet the growing automotive and consumer electronics demands. Moreover, the adoption of electric and autonomous vehicles is accelerating the need for reliable and high-performance imaging sensors.

Market Drivers and Key Growth Factors
The GMSL2 camera module market is being propelled by several critical drivers:
-
Increasing Adoption in Automotive ADAS Systems: Advanced driver-assistance systems rely on high-resolution cameras to enhance vehicle safety, pedestrian detection, and lane monitoring, boosting market demand.
-
Rising Industrial Automation: The need for precise machine vision systems in factories and production lines is creating new opportunities for GMSL2 camera modules.
-
High-Speed Data Transmission Requirement: GMSL2 technology supports high-bandwidth video transmission, which is critical for modern vehicles and industrial applications.
Additionally, governments worldwide are implementing strict safety regulations for vehicles, further encouraging manufacturers to integrate advanced imaging modules. The growth of smart cities and intelligent transportation systems also supports market expansion.
Market Restraints and Challenges
Despite strong growth prospects, the market faces certain challenges that could limit expansion:
-
High Cost of Advanced Camera Modules: Integration of high-resolution, low-latency modules can increase production costs for automotive manufacturers.
-
Complexity in System Integration: Installing and calibrating multiple camera modules in vehicles requires skilled engineering, which may slow adoption.
-
Compatibility Concerns: Differences in vehicle architectures and standards may create integration challenges for some manufacturers.
Addressing these challenges through cost-effective manufacturing and standardization will be crucial for sustaining growth in the GMSL2 camera module market.
